    These cookies/biscotti are wonderful. I didn't have any anise, so used 2 tsp vanilla instead and they were delicious. I took another reviewers suggestion and dipped them in melted chocolate-yummy! They make a beautiful presentation and would be a great gift or the perfect dessert with coffee. I will be making these many times in the future, absolutely delish!!

    I loved this recipe! I substituted the Anise with Almond Extract and added chopped slivered almonds with the chocolate chips. They tasted great! I will definitely make this recipe again!
